>does anyone know of some undocumented feature to set the keyword
>ACK really off. I'm a LISTOWNER, and we want to use this special list
>to look like a normal userid.
>So is there any possibility for something like ACK= Off ?
I have privately asked Eric for Ack= None to be valid since I have lists
that I don't want anyone to know are lists by ack messages.
For example, HELPDESK is a list that I want forwarded to two other lists.
Yet, I don't want the originator to see three messages about processing
his/her mail to each list (some users will think that everyone in the
computer center is seeing a dumb question.
Another example, DIRECTOR is a list that is the director and his secretarial
staff (when he's out, someone can cover his mail). Changes in the staff are
a local concern and all mail to DIRECTOR gets to the right people.
